The Retail IT Service Desk is a centralized support system that handles all IT-related inquiries, incidents, and service requests within a retail organization. This could range from troubleshooting technical issues with point-of-sale systems, managing inventory systems, assisting with online orders, or providing support for store employees using various devices and software applications. The primary goal of the Retail IT Service Desk is to ensure that technology functions properly, minimize downtime, and ultimately enhance the overall customer experience.
One of the key benefits of having a dedicated Retail IT Service Desk is the ability to provide timely and effective support to store employees and customers. Retail operations rely heavily on technology, from inventory management systems to digital signage and mobile POS devices. When issues arise, such as a malfunctioning scanner or slow internet connection, it can disrupt the flow of business and impact the customer experience. Having a knowledgeable and responsive IT service desk team in place can help resolve these issues quickly and efficiently, minimizing disruptions and keeping operations running smoothly.
In addition to providing technical support, the Retail IT Service Desk also plays a critical role in improving operational efficiency and productivity. By centralizing IT support functions, retail organizations can streamline processes, standardize procedures, and implement best practices across all stores. This consistency not only helps to ensure a high level of service but also allows for better tracking of issues, faster resolution times, and more accurate reporting on IT performance metrics.
